new function for registering item for drop grass/junglegrass

master
A. Demant 2018-09-10 16:19:31 +02:00
parent 0b86e5c801
commit 7baf16e8a4
1 changed files with 14 additions and 9 deletions

View File

@ -1,21 +1,24 @@
local function farming_update_grass_item()
local function farming_update_grass_item(type_grass)
for i = 4,5 do
minetest.override_item("default:grass_"..i, {
minetest.override_item("default:"..type_grass.."_"..i, {
drop = { max_items = 3,
items = {farming.grass,
items = {"default:grass_1" 3}}
items = {farming[type_grass],
items = {"default:"..type_grass.."_1"},items = {"default:grass_1"},items = {"default:grass_1"}}
}
})
end
end
function farming_register_grass_item(item,rarity)
farming.grass[#farming.grass+1]={items=item,rarity=rarity}
function farming_register_grass_item(type_grass,item,rarity)
farming[type_grass][#farming.grass+1]={items=item,rarity=rarity}
end
farming_register_grass_item("farming:seed_wheat",5)
farming_register_grass_item("farming:seed_spelt",5)
farming_update_grass_item()
farming_register_grass_item("grass","farming:seed_wheat",5)
farming_register_grass_item("grass","farming:seed_spelt",5)
farming_update_grass_item("grass")
farming_register_grass_item("junglegrass","farming:seed_cotton",8)
farming_update_grass_item("junglegrass")
--[[
for i = 4, 5 do
@ -50,6 +53,7 @@ end
]]
-- Override default Jungle Grass and have it drop Cotton Seeds
--[[
minetest.override_item("default:junglegrass", {
drop = {
max_items = 1,
@ -59,3 +63,4 @@ minetest.override_item("default:junglegrass", {
}
},
})
]]